1. 项目背景与核心价值
去年参与某电力系统仿真项目时,第一次接触到PSCAD/EMTDC这款电磁暂态仿真软件。作为电力系统仿真领域的工业级标准工具,PSCAD的Co-Simulation API功能允许用户将第三方程序与仿真环境深度集成。但在实际开发中,英文技术文档的阅读门槛让团队耗费了大量时间。这正是我们启动这个翻译项目的初衷——通过高质量的技术文档本地化,降低国内工程师的使用门槛。
这个翻译项目聚焦PSCAD官方Co-Simulation API文档的技术性转化,采用DeepSeek智能翻译引擎作为基础工具,结合电力系统专业术语库进行二次校准。最终产出的中文说明书不仅包含准确的术语对照,还针对API调用流程、数据交互机制等核心功能添加了实用批注。
2. 技术文档翻译的工程化实践
2.1 翻译工具链搭建
我们采用三阶段处理流水线:
- 预处理阶段:使用Python脚本提取PDF文档中的文本和图表,通过正则表达式识别技术术语(如"snubber circuit"对应"缓冲电路")
- 核心翻译阶段:配置DeepSeek引擎的领域参数:
python复制{ "domain": "power_systems", "term_base": "pscad_glossary.json", "style_guide": "IEC_standard" } - 后处理阶段:用LaTeX重构文档排版,特别处理公式编号交叉引用
关键提示:电力系统文档中的缩略语(如FFT、HVDC)必须保持原貌,仅在首次出现时添加中文注释
2.2 专业术语处理方案
建立四级术语管理体系:
- 强制锁定术语(如"transient analysis"固定译为"暂态分析")
- 语境敏感术语(如"bridge"在电力电子场景译作"桥臂"而非普通含义)
- 品牌保留术语(如"Manitoba HVDC Research Centre"不翻译)
- 计量单位处理(统一转换为国际单位制,如"mile"→"千米")
实测发现,经过训练的翻译引擎在电力电子专业段落中的术语准确率从68%提升至92%。
3. PSCAD API文档的技术要点解析
3.1 协同仿真架构设计
PSCAD的API采用客户端-服务器模式,通过共享内存实现实时数据交换。文档详细说明了三种集成方式:
- Socket通信:适合跨平台场景,延迟约15ms
- COM接口:Windows平台专用,延迟<5ms
- DLL动态库:性能最优(延迟<1ms),但需处理内存管理
我们特别在翻译中添加了调用示例对比:
fortran复制! 原文档示例
CALL PSCAD_API_INIT(sim_id, status)
! 中文版补充说明
! sim_id: 仿真实例标识符(需>1000)
! status: 返回码(0=成功,详见附录E)
3.2 关键参数映射表
| 英文参数名 | 中文译名 | 数据类型 | 取值范围 |
|---|---|---|---|
| time_step | 仿真步长 | double | 1μs-100ms |
| fault_resistance | 故障电阻 | real array | [0.01, 1e6] Ω |
| control_flag | 控制标志位 | integer | 0x0000-0xFFFF |
4. 技术文档翻译的实战经验
4.1 典型问题处理方案
遇到文档中的歧义表述时,我们采用三步验证法:
- 在PSCAD X4.6实际环境中复现API调用
- 对比EMTDC求解器日志
- 咨询 Manitoba 官方技术支持论坛
例如原文"the array index starts at 0 by default"在电力系统控制场景中实际测试发现,部分老版本固件默认从1开始计数。我们在翻译中添加了版本兼容性说明。
4.2 质量控制指标体系
建立翻译质量的量化评估标准:
- 术语一致性 ≥98%
- 图示标注准确率 100%
- API示例代码可执行率 100%
- 技术概念错误零容忍
通过自动化检查脚本实现每日构建验证:
bash复制# 术语一致性检查
python3 validate_terms.py --glossary glossary.csv --target translated.docx
5. 工程文档本地化的进阶技巧
在完成基础翻译后,我们添加了这些增值内容:
- 典型错误代码速查表:整理23种常见API错误码的解决方案
- 性能优化指南:根据中国电网特点调整的仿真参数建议
- 调试工具集:配套开发的API调用监视器(可显示实时数据流)
特别在动态仿真部分,补充了国内工程师熟悉的BPA与PSCAD参数对照参考。实测表明,这些本地化改进使新用户上手时间缩短40%。
这个项目让我深刻体会到,优秀的技术文档翻译不是简单的语言转换,而是需要建立在对领域知识的深刻理解之上。现在当我在电力系统仿真论坛看到有人讨论Co-Simulation API的应用时,总会建议他们结合中文说明书和原版文档交叉参考——毕竟某些技术细节的微妙之处,往往藏在两种语言的表述差异之中。